Early Middle Ages- Romanesque Architecture Reflected Roman influences Like fortresses: thick walls and towers Roof was a barrel vault, a long tunnel of stone Very few or no windows

Romanesque Interior Round arches Simple ceiling Dark with few windows

Gothic Architecture Pointed arches Flying buttresses Stained glass windows Elaborate, ornate interior Taller and more airy- let in light Elaborate, larger than life sculpture
10
St. Denis Cathedral, Paris Abbot Suger hoped that St. Denis would “shine with wonderful and uninterrupted light” One of the first truly “gothic” Cathedrals
